- Content Description: Photograph used for a story in the Oklahoma Times newspaper. Caption: "OPENING CONCERT of the Oklahoma City Symphony's 32nd season was all-orchestral and wecomed warmly. The concert will be repeated Tuesday at 8:15 p.m. in Civic Center Music Hall Traditionally, a reception honoring the orchestra members, their spouses and Dr. and Mrs. Guy fraser Harrison (he's conductor) is given after the opening concert by the symphony society. held at Val Gene's Red Eagle, it had two new honorees- Frederick Moyer, new manager of the orchestra, and Mrs. Moyer. Among the guests were, photo above, Mr. and Mrs. R. D. Phillips, Madill, and daughters, Dana, Anette and Patti, Mrs. Phillips is a state board member of the society."
